What is The Hill E-Edition? Description of The Hill E-Edition

The Hill is the definitive digital source for non-partisan political news and information—providing you with agenda-setting reporting on what’s happening in Washington, and why it matters. This e-edition complements our core news app and offers subscribers a curated experience that you can read through in a single sitting or complete at your leisure. Download the whole edition for offline reading during travel.
